Evaluating existing plumbing systems is an important step in any type of shower room installment task. A thorough evaluation enables plumbing technicians to determine possible problems that might develop throughout expansions or restorations. This analysis consists of checking pipes for leaks, corrosion, or blockages and gauging water stress and flow rates.Plumbers additionally check out the water drainage system to confirm it can manage the extra load from new components. Recognizing the current format and condition of the pipes assists in determining necessary upgrades or modifications.Additionally, plumbing professionals inspect compliance with local building codes and regulations, verifying that any type of adjustments made fulfill security criteria. This cautious exam not only avoids pricey troubles however also ensures that the brand-new restroom features effectively and effectively. By addressing existing pipes difficulties upfront, plumbings play an important function in assisting in an effective restroom installation procedure, eventually resulting in a more enjoyable end result for homeowners.

Guaranteeing Leak-Free Connections



Guaranteeing leak-free links throughout the installment of fixtures and fittings is necessary for an effective shower room project. Plumbings play a crucial duty by carefully inspecting all joints and connections throughout the setup process. They use premium products such as Teflon tape and proper sealants to stop leaks, assuring that water moves only where intended. Each link should be tightened to specific This Site specs to avoid future concerns. Furthermore, plumbings perform complete assessments after installation, screening fixtures under stress to identify any kind of prospective leakages. This positive strategy not only safeguards versus water damage yet also boosts the longevity of the pipes system. Ultimately, their expertise ensures a efficient and trustworthy bathroom configuration, providing assurance for home owners.


Handling Water and Drainage



Efficient monitoring of water and drain is crucial for a successful shower room installment (Contractor Stoke-On-Trent). An experienced plumbing professional assesses the existing plumbing infrastructure to figure out one of the most reliable format for new components. This consists of determining water pressure and making certain sufficient supply lines for toilets, showers, and sinks. Proper water drainage is equally essential; the plumbing technician needs to mount waste pipelines at the proper incline to promote smooth water circulation and protect against clogs.Additionally, the plumber must select proper products, such as PVC or copper, based on local building ordinance and the specific requirements of the bathroom layout. They likewise think about the distance of the restroom to the main water drainage system to decrease prospective problems. By meticulously planning and implementing the pipes arrangement, the plumbing technician plays an important role in staying clear of future pipes problems and ensuring that the washroom works properly for several years to find


Final Examinations and Upkeep Tips



Completing a washroom setup requires detailed final inspections to validate every little thing features as meant. A qualified plumbing will assess all installations, consisting of faucets, bathrooms, and shower systems, making sure there are no leakages, clogs, or inappropriate fittings. This action is vital for protecting against future problems that could develop from unnoticed errors.After the installment, routine upkeep is vital. Property owners need to regularly look for leaks around components and evaluate caulking for wear. Cleaning drains pipes with a combination of baking soft drink and vinegar can aid avoid build-up and clogs. It is recommended to purge commodes and run faucets on a regular basis to guarantee they remain in great functioning order.Additionally, a plumbing may suggest organizing yearly inspections to catch any type of possible troubles early. By following these maintenance suggestions and performing thorough final evaluations, house owners can appreciate a functional and efficient shower room for many years ahead.
